In a proceeding for custodial responsibility of a child of a service member or civilian employee, a court may not consider a parent’s past deployment or possible future deployment in itself in determining the best interest of the child, but may consider any significant impact on the best interest of the child of the parent’s past or possible future deployment.
NRS 125C.0647 — General considerations in custody proceeding of parent’s military service.
